When rabbits are happy or excited, they will often thump their back feet on the ground. This is … WebCover the top of the baseboards with masking tape. Since the texture of baseboards is often what causes rabbits to chew on them, using masking tape over top can cause some rabbits to lose interest. Use a bitter apple spray on the baseboards. A bitter apple spray can be used to make the baseboards taste bad to rabbits.

WebRabbits are extremely territorial, and may exhibit behaviors such as chinning, and urinating, chasing, batting, biting, or mounting. Introductions should be done in a neutral space to minimize the occurrence of these territorial behaviors.
